Tamales are filled and hand-wrapped gifts of masa deliciousness. Discover what makes these Mexican delicacies so special as you fill and wrap (surprisingly easily!) your own hand-formed bites of wonder, and top them with handmade salsa verde.
This live-streaming class can be booked as a one-on-one or group class for 2 to 12 people.
Let me show you just how fun and easy making tamales and salsa by hand can be. You’ll be guided step-by-step through softening the corn husks, prepping your fillings, preparing your masa, and forming and filling, and wrapping your tamales. As you put them on the stove to steam, we’ll make a fresh salsa to enjoy with your warm tamales. At the end of this class, you’ll have fresh salsa and a dozen steamed-to-perfection tamales to enjoy!
The recipe and a list of ingredients and supplies will be sent after booking.
Vegetarian, vegan, plant-based, gluten-free, and dairy-free diets are accommodated.
